Down by the Lellobee Farm Ella uses her tools to pick vegetables, scatter grain, plant flowers, dig weeds and rake leaves.
Lellobee City Farm is a new kids cartoon show from the creators of CoComelon.

CoComelon’s 3D animation and songs create a world that centers on the everyday experiences of young children. In addition to helping preschoolers learn letters, numbers, animal sounds, colors, and more, the videos impart prosocial life lessons, providing parents with an opportunity to teach and play with their children as they watch together.
